Transaction 105c56ba45571e9d418a4bb5b42fa72b2f6451a20d8b3e5fcb3865c68bc51f2d
1 Input
1 Output
-
105c56ba45571e9d418a4bb5b42fa72b2f6451a20d8b3e5fcb3865c68bc51f2d:0
- value
- 2414913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83a06576a6435136a8712995a52713c273c7d9fc OP_EQUAL
- address
- 3DgzbCwiU2ntzC4M1rQskCkgNkwjJ8HS3Z